Role Definition Our team is focused on evolving the state of the art and bringing emerging automation & autonomy technology into the harsh production environments found on typical mining and construction jobsites. As a System Integration Engineer focusing on autonomous mining trucks, you'll collaborate with team members to develop new autonomous truck models and features that provide critical value to our customers.

Every day you will work with your team to solve real world problems by selecting the right approach and bringing those solutions to production. We have a fabulous team that does some of the most exciting work at Caterpillar, and we can't wait for you to join the team!

Responsibilities

  • Design system architectures for autonomy systems deployed on an ecosystem of truck models
  • Definition of electronic interfaces and electronic system design
  • Manage I/O requirements for machine control hardware and other autonomy-related devices
  • Collaborate with partner teams to create hardware solutions that meet business and technical requirements.
  • Coordinate and execute logistics to progress hardware system changes through validation environments, field trials, and into production.
  • System troubleshooting and issue resolution.
